The 10th edition of the National Health IT Summit was held on 17 July 2018, at the Singapore Expo. Organised by IHiS, the annual flagship event was the largest in scale to date, and brought together more than 800 attendees from public and private healthcare, as well as partner agencies, to glean insights on ways to transform the core of Singapore’s healthcare, and learn more about emerging technologies and innovative concepts.
 
Themed “Smart Health: Innovate and Scale”, the Summit focused on scaling innovation in healthcare, and featured a strong line-up of distinguished local and overseas speakers such as Dr Ali Parsa (babylon) and Dr Brian Gerkey (Open Robotics), whose expertise run the gamut from chatbots to robots. Delegates were able to gain insights beyond the local scene, which allowed them to reflect on their own innovation journey thus far.

About National Health IT Summit 2018

The National Health IT Summit is an annual flagship forum that brings public healthcare policy makers and senior leaders from Singapore’s public and private healthcare sector under one roof for a day of high-level discussions, insightful talks and networking.
 
Organised by Integrated Health Information Systems (IHiS) and supported by the Ministry of Health, Singapore (MOH), the by-invitation-only event has grown in scale and significance over the years, and is now the premier platform for the exchange of ideas and strategies among leading thinkers and practitioners from healthcare institutions, corporations and government agencies.
 
The theme for this year’s event is “Smart Health: Innovate and Scale”. A stellar line-up of distinguished international experts has been assembled to share their perspectives, insights and experiences pertaining to these thematic thrusts, including speakers from recognised market leaders in diverse fields ranging from artificial intelligence to robotics, such as babylon and Open Robotics.

Let’s C.H.A.T (Conversation on Health and Technology) panel discussion
In this panel discussion, senior leaders from the healthcare and public sector will dissect and debate the issues surrounding the transformation of healthcare in Singapore through innovation, most notably the challenges of scaling and what needs to be done to facilitate the faster adoption and proliferation of innovations in order to extend their benefits beyond the few to the many. 

National HealthTech Challenge
The National HealthTech Challenge is a platform that aggregates demand for health technology solutions, pools funding within the innovation and startup ecosystems, and brings together people from Singapore's public healthcare institutions and solution providers to improve healthcare.

National Health IT Excellence Awards Ceremony
Guest-of-Honour Minister for Health Mr Gan Kim Yong will present the National Health IT Excellence Awards to recognise the contribution and achievements of public and private healthcare institutions and individuals that have achieved excellence through IT.
